What's The Definition Of Emollient?
emollient
An emollient cream makes your skin softer or reduces pain. variable noun: An emollient is a liquid or cream which you put on your skin to make it softer or to reduce pain. emollient in American English softening; soothing something that has a softening or soothing effect; esp., an emollient preparation or medicine applied to surface tissues of the body adjective: having the power of softening or relaxing, as a medicinal substance; soothing, esp. to the skin noun: an emollient medicine, lotion, salve, etc emollient in British English adjective: softening or soothing, esp to the skin noun: any preparation or substance that has a softening or soothing effect, esp when applied to the skin |
